Broadridge Appoints Frank Troise as President of Global Capital Markets

Broadridge Financial Solutions has announced the immediate appointment of Frank Troise as President of Global Capital Markets. Reporting to Tom Carey, President of Global Technology & Operations, Troise will join the company’s Executive Leadership Team. This leadership transition occurs as the industry experiences a significant convergence of trading, financing, and post-trade services across both traditional and digital financial ecosystems.

Since joining the firm in 2024 as Head of Trading and Connectivity Solutions, Troise has been instrumental in enhancing Broadridge’s platform capabilities. His work has focused on driving strategic growth and expanding front-office offerings, specifically within execution management, analytics, and algorithmic trading.

Troise brings extensive executive experience to the role, having previously served as CEO of Pico Quantitative Trading and ITG. His background also includes leading J.P. Morgan’s global Execution Services business, where he managed cross-asset trading operations. His appointment is intended to strengthen Broadridge’s position as a provider of integrated technology solutions for global capital markets.
